titleOfInvention Benzotriazole derivative and reagent for analysis of carboxylic acids containing above-mentioned derivative
abstract NEW MATERIAL:A benzotriazole derivative expressed by formula I [R 1 is 1-5C alkylene; R 2 and R 3 are mutually same or different and represent H, 1-5C alkyl, 1-5C alkyloxy, amino, mono- or di- 1-5C alkylamino (excluding when they are not simultaneously H) or together form 1-5C alkylenedioxy; R 4 is H or 1-5C alkyl) or salt thereof. n EXAMPLE: 2-(p-Aminomethylphenyl)-N,N-dimethyl-2H-benzotriazolyl-5--amine. n USE: A reagent for analysis of carboxylic acids capable of reacting with carboxylic acids in mild conditions and rapidly measuring in high sensitivity. n PREPARATION: For example, a substituted aniline expressed by formula II is subjected to well-known diazo coupling reaction with a diazo compound having aminoalkul group protected with a proper protecting group expressed by formula III, oxidative ring-closure reaction and successively deprotecting to provide the compound expressed by formula I. n COPYRIGHT: (C)1989,JPO&Japio
